Buddhist temple
Byodo-ji is a Koyasan Shingon temple in , , Japan. Temple # 22 on the Shikoku 88 temple pilgrimage. The main image is of Yakushi Nyorai. It is designated as Anan Muroto Historical Cultural Road. is situated 630 metres northeast of Todoroki Shrine.
